Output df8cd7ace8a5637c3f287169a52d855306461830c08d12b73a0a4c0e7d1b4dfe:5

value
18129695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1dd5f309d3a528ae024d61eb1f0566359c58459 OP_EQUAL
address
MNf2DVw99zDprU3hk5JAgJedsavkVLhe4S
transaction
df8cd7ace8a5637c3f287169a52d855306461830c08d12b73a0a4c0e7d1b4dfe
spent
true